I'm creating some dashboards for use by our entire development team. Basically, it's a set of 7 saved searches displayed as pretty little bar charts or line graphs. None of them are real-time searches. If 20 people suddenly decide to load the dashboard at the same time, does this put a load of 140 searches on Splunk all at the same time?

Is there a way to make the dashboard simply display the last result of that saved search? I could easily schedule these searches to run once an hour if that would reduce load on the search heads when lots of developers fire up Splunk each morning.

By default, a dashboard will use saved results of a scheduled search, if in fact the panel is built referencing the scheduled search, and if the security of the search is set so that the users can see the search.
